The SmartElex BQ24074 Solar Lithium Ion/Poly Charger is an all-in-one charging solution for your Li-Ion and Li-Poly batteries. With a USB Type-C port, DC, and solar input options, it ensures efficient charging. It features up to 1.5A charge rate, up to 10V input voltage, and prioritizes external power to prevent unnecessary battery cycling. Its Power Good LED and built-in protections make it an ideal, cost-effective charging solution.

Features:

  1. USB Type-C for modern connectivity.
  2. Supports up to 1.5A charge rate.
  3. Wide input voltage range (up to 10V, 28V protected).
  4. Smart load sharing prevents unnecessary battery wear.
  5. Regulated load output for compatibility with 3.3V/5V systems.
  6. Power Good LED for clear charging status.
  7. Cost-effective and easy-to-use design.
